基于编织结构的混凝土壳体建造研究

Concrete Shell Construction Based on Weaving Structure

摘要 混凝土壳体是一种优美却不易建造的建筑形式,设计方法的复杂性以及建造需要的大量人力限制了它的应用。研究借助一种能够建造自由曲面的编织结构,提出了一种创新性的混凝土壳体施工方法,意图在保证壳体成形的情况下使建造更便宜、操作更方便。该方法基于我们提出的一种主动弯曲的编织结构,由编织结构模具、承载面和边缘节点三层系统组成。这种基于编织结构的混凝土壳体建造方法的优势在于,编织结构不仅能够节省建造的时间、材料和人力投入,而且可以在不使用数控加工设备的情况下实现混凝土壳体形状的多样性。 The concrete shell is always regarded as an aesthetic but hard-actualized type of architecture in a long period.The main obstruction lies in complicated shape forming and expensive input of technologies and labors,which naturally restrict that construction operated in some remote areas.To better the situation in low-tech places,this research is carried out to explore a novel concrete shell construction method,which is freeform,cheap,easy-conducted without an obvious decline of quality.This new method is based on an innovative forming technology called weaving structure,a bending-active rod system.The system consists of three layers:weaving structure mode,supportive layer and edge joint system.It is favorably proved that weaving structure mold not only brings enormous savings in various aspects including money,labors and time but also allows the diversity of concrete shapes without advanced equipment.
